نَا أَبُو الْعَبَّاسِ بْنُ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 الْعَسْكَرِيُّ ، نَا الْحُنَيْنِيُّ ، نَا أَبُو غَسَّانَ ، نَا قَيْسٌ ، عَنْ جَابِرٍ ، عَنْ عِكْرِمَةَ ، عَنِ ابْنِ عَبَّاسٍ ، قَالَ : قَ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 : " كُتِبَ عَلَيَّ النَّحْرُ ، وَلَمْ يُكْتَبْ عَلَيْكُمْ ، وَأُمِرْتُ بِصَلاةِ الأَضْحَى ، وَلَمْ تُؤْمَرُوا بِهَا " ، قَالَ : وَحَدَّثَنَا الْحُنَيْنِيُّ ، نَا أَبُو نُعَيْمٍ ، نَا الْحَسَنُ بْنُ صَالِحٍ ، عَنْ جَابِرٍ مِثْلَهُ : كُتِبَ عَلَيَّ الأَضْحَى.
Sayyiduna Abdullah bin Abbas (may Allah be pleased with them both) narrates that the Noble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) said: "Sacrificing (an animal) has been made obligatory upon me, but it has not been made obligatory upon you people. I have been commanded to perform the Eid al-Adha prayer, but you have not been commanded to do so." This narration is also transmitted with another chain of narration.
